Job overview

Winchester House School is looking to appoint a well-qualified, inspirational and creative Director of Music and Arts to lead and develop Music and Arts in this 3-13 co-educational school. 

This opportunity would ideally suit an experienced head of department or an ambitious teacher looking to progress their career.

The successful candidate will possess excellent leadership and management skills to lead the department, be keen and able to develop Music and Arts throughout the school to build on the department’s excellent reputation and be able to teach all abilities from Nursery to Year 8.
